Publishers Text

Take a dash of western myth, a healthy sprinkle of vintage photographs, and a dollop of tall tales and instructional sidebars, simmer with a delicious selection of western recipes, and, voila - The Cowgirl's Cookbook. From June's Ranch Beans to Joan's Chile Rellenos, Connie's Cackleberries on Toast to Rita's Tomato Mac 'n Cheese, these hearty fixin's will feed a city girl's fantasy as well as a country boy's belly. Filled with fun recipes and nostalgic looks back at the heyday of the cowgirl era, this book celebrates the wild women of the Old West. From "Fit for a Queen Green Chili Soup" to "Cowgirl Margaritas," Cowgirl's Cookbook is fun to peruse and will be excellent to use for a cowgirl-themed girls night or campout. A sure favorite with locals and tourists alike, these recipes ain't just for trail drives no more!
